You are first assessed on your own pace and then you are assessed at the computer’s pace. You will be given two sample tests and then afterwards the real thing begins. The computer will tell you the results for the two sample tests. Example if you do well: it will say you have done well.

WebTo obtain a train driving licence you must pass a general professional competence examination, a medical examination and an occupational psychological fitness examination. It mainly aims to assess various cognitive functions needed for driving. In the visual search test, your error-finding, matching, attention skills and reaction times are assessed. Train Drivers need to pay attention to what is happening on their dashboards.
